48v Lifepo4 Battery

The 48 v Lifepo4 Battery offers several performance advantages over traditional lead-acid batteries. Its higher energy density allows for more compact storage solutions, while its extended lifespan significantly reduces the frequency of replacements and associated costs. The 48v Lifepo4 Battery inherent thermal and chemical stability make it safer and more reliable in various applications.

 Additionally, Lifepo4 batteries provide a consistent discharge rate and maintain performance across a wide temperature range, ensuring dependable power availability. These attributes make the 48 v Lifepo4 Battery a superior choice for efficient and safe power backup.

Ways in which a 48 v Lifepo4 Battery Increases Safety in Backup Systems

The 48 v Lifepo4 Battery excels in safety due to its robust design that resists overheating and thermal runaway, which are common issues with other battery types. Its chemical structure minimises explosion or fire risks, ensuring users’ peace of mind. Advanced safety features, such as built-in battery management systems, monitor and regulate voltage and temperature. These systems provide an extra layer of protection, enhancing overall safety.

One of the key safety features of the 48 v Lifepo4 Battery is its built-in battery management system (BMS). This system constantly monitors the battery’s performance, regulating voltage, temperature, and current to prevent unsafe conditions. The BMS will automatically adjust the system to avoid damage if any abnormal conditions are detected. This added layer of protection ensures that the battery operates safely and efficiently, providing peace of mind for users.

How a 48v Battery Lifepo4 Enhances Power Reliability

The 48 v Lifepo4 Battery is becoming increasingly popular for commercial and residential applications due to its outstanding performance and reliability. It is designed to withstand various conditions and offers dependable power.

Dependable Power across Temperatures

One of the standout features of the 48 v Lifepo4 Battery is its ability to maintain performance across diverse temperature ranges. This ensures that users can rely on it in hot and cold environments, making it an ideal choice for applications in regions with fluctuating temperatures.

Stable Discharge Rate for Consistent Power

Another key benefit is the battery’s stable discharge rate. Unlike other battery types that may experience power dips under load, the LiFePO4 provides a steady supply of power, even when the energy demand is high. This makes it particularly useful for backup power systems, where reliability is critical.

Low Self-Discharge Rate for Long-Term Reliability

In addition to its consistent performance, the 48v Battery Lifepo4 boasts a low self-discharge rate. This means it retains its charge over long periods, reducing the need for frequent recharging or maintenance. Whether used for off-grid systems or as backup power, this feature enhances reliability, ensuring users have power when needed.

With its stable discharge, temperature resilience, and low self-discharge, the 48 v Lifepo4 Battery is an excellent choice for reliable, long-lasting energy storage.

Examining the Longevity of a 48 v Lifepo4 Battery for Backup Systems

The 48 v Lifepo4 Battery is notable for its impressive durability, often exceeding 2000 charge cycles. This extended lifespan ensures reliable service over several years, reducing the frequency of replacements. The battery’s long life also lowers total ownership costs, making it a cost-effective solution for long-term power backup needs. Additionally, its robust construction and stable performance over time mean fewer concerns about degradation, further enhancing its value for backup systems.

FAQs

What makes a 48v Lifepo4 Battery safer than other battery types?

The 48v Lifepo4 Battery is known for its enhanced safety features, including its resistance to thermal runaway and overheating, which are common risks with other battery technologies. Its chemical composition reduces the risk of explosion or fire, while built-in battery management systems ensure the proper regulation of voltage and temperature, providing an extra layer of protection.

 How does a 48 v Lifepo4 Battery compare to lead-acid batteries in terms of lifespan?

A 48 v Lifepo4 Battery generally lasts much longer than traditional lead-acid batteries. While lead-acid batteries typically offer around 500 to 1,000 charge cycles, the Lifepo4 battery can last up to 2,000 or more, significantly reducing replacement costs and contributing to long-term savings.

Can a 48 v Lifepo4 Battery be used for off-grid applications?

Yes, the 48 v Lifepo4 Battery is highly suitable for off-grid applications. It offers reliable energy storage in remote areas thanks to its compact design, ability to perform in varying temperatures, and long lifespan, reducing the need for frequent replacements.

How does the 48 v Lifepo4 Battery improve energy efficiency?

The 48 v Lifepo4 Battery boasts high round-trip efficiency, meaning less energy is lost during charging and discharging cycles. This increased efficiency makes it an ideal choice for systems where energy conservation is key, such as solar power installations.

 Is a 48 v Lifepo4 Battery eco-friendly?

Yes, Lifepo4 batteries are considered eco-friendly due to their non-toxic materials, high energy efficiency, and extended lifespan. Compared to traditional lead-acid batteries, they produce fewer emissions and generate less waste, contributing to a more sustainable energy solution.
